Abstract
The utility model relates to an oil processing filter core cures cleaning device belongs to oil processing equipment technical field. The utility model provides a current oil add the problem of the not good clearance of filter core of process man-hour. The utility model comprises a baking furnace for heating the filter element and burning and carbonizing impurities attached to the surface of the filter element; the spray tower is used for spraying gas generated in the baking furnace and is communicated with the top of the baking furnace through a gas recovery pipeline; the oil-water separation device is communicated with the lower part of the spray tower through an oil-water separation pipeline and is communicated with the spray liquid in the spray tower, the spray return pipeline is communicated with the bottom of the spray tower and the spray end at the top of the spray tower, and a water pump is arranged on the spray return pipeline.

Background
Oil processing is a very important link in petroleum processing production, so that the oil can become qualified finished oil and other products, the oil needs to be filtered before being processed, and the filtering is generally finished by adopting a filter element. Residual oil impurities are attached to the filtered filter element, and after the filter element is used for a long time, the oil impurities can block the filter element, so that the filtering capacity of the filter element is greatly reduced.
At present, a filter element for filtering needs to be frequently replaced, the filter element after replacement needs to be cleaned, but a large amount of oil impurities attached to the filter element are difficult to clean and cannot be normally recycled, a lot of oil impurities can be abandoned, and waste is serious.

Detailed Description
The present invention will be further explained with reference to the accompanying drawings.
As shown in fig. 1-2, an oil processing filter core cures cleaning device, include:
a baking furnace 1 for heating the filter element and burning and carbonizing impurities attached to the surface of the filter element;
the spray tower 3 is used for spraying gas generated in the baking furnace 1, and the spray tower 3 is communicated with the top of the baking furnace 1 through a gas recovery pipeline 2;
the device comprises an oil-water separation device 4 for performing oil-water separation on the liquid sprayed in the spray tower 3, wherein the oil-water separation device 4 is communicated with the lower part of the spray tower 3 through an oil-water separation pipeline 10 and is communicated with the spray liquid in the spray tower 3, a spray return pipeline 7 is communicated with the bottom of the spray tower 3 and the top spray end of the spray tower 3, a water pump is arranged on the spray return pipeline 7, and the top air outlet end of the spray tower 3 is communicated with a waste gas treatment device 5.
The baking furnace 1 comprises an upper baking upper cover 1-5 at the top and a lower baking shell;
the baking lower shell comprises a heat-insulating outer shell 1-1, a refractory material inner shell 1-3 and an electric heating pipe 1-2 arranged between the heat-insulating outer shell 1-1 and the refractory material inner shell 1-3, wherein a baking support net 1-4 is arranged on the inner side of the refractory material inner shell 1-3.
A plurality of groups of temperature sensors 1-6 are arranged on the baking furnace 1, and the temperature sensors 1-6 are extended into the inner sides of the refractory inner shells 1-3.
The outer side of the baking furnace 1 adopts a heat-insulating outer shell 1-1, so that heat radiation and heat loss are reduced, energy is saved, and the inner side adopts a refractory material inner shell 1-3, so that the requirement of high temperature can be better met, and the requirement of baking a filter element is met. The temperature sensors 1-6 are thermocouples and can well measure the temperature of the inner side, so that the temperature of the inner side of the baking furnace 1 can be conveniently fed back and adjusted, and the filter element can be better baked. The impurity oil product attached to the filter element is burnt to form carbon dioxide, so that the subsequent water cleaning of the filter element is facilitated.
The oil outlet end of the oil-water separation device 4 is communicated with the sewage removal oil tank 6 through a separated oil recovery pipeline 9, and the water outlet end of the oil-water separation device 4 is communicated to the spraying return pipeline 7 through a separated water circulation pipeline 8. The water can be recycled conveniently, and the water is saved.
The utility model discloses a working process as follows:
the filter core is placed on a baking support net 1-4 in the baking furnace 1 for baking, the internal temperature is controlled through a temperature sensor 1-6, carbonization of oil impurities attached to the filter core can be well guaranteed, waste gas after carbonization enters the spray tower 3 for spraying treatment, liquid after spraying enters the oil-water separation device 4 for separation, separated water enters the spray return pipeline 7 of the spray tower 3 for recycling, and oil enters the decontamination oil tank 6 for recycling and decontamination.
